> I have a microprocessor based controller board developed around Motorola's
> 68HC11.  It has expanded RAM and ROM and other I/O and so it uses two quad
> NOR gates chips as glue logic.  There is also an LCD which, due to it's
> slower than bus speed, is connected to a port.  I'd love to wrap all this
> up into one chip.
> 
> I'm aware of these programmable logic devices, have downloaded National
> Semiconductor's Opal Jr. and got real excited until I remembered that
> having a file to download is only half the equation!  How then to burn the
> device?
> 
> Is there is a publication from National or whomever that has a circuit
> with timing diagrams, I can create the circuit and program a 68HC11 to
> perform the burn.  Is there any such beast?  Any thing else I should look
> into?  I know there are commercial products, like PROM burners, but it
> just doesn't seem to be that hard... or is it?

I've just booked to go to a Lattice seminar. They sell a starter kit
for 50 pounds (UK) that includes software, sample chips (like an
in-system programmable 22V10 GAL and others) and a connection cable
that plugs into the printer port. The seminar only costs 24 pounds,
and you get the starter kit *and* a programmer board (100 pounds
worth). This looks like the cheapest way to get into this type
of programmable logic. I especially like the idea of programming
the chips in-circuit. I found one of their data books in the library
at work, and there are some interesting application notes in it.
